As far as the writer's conference, there were around 150 people there, who were broken down into smaller groups, depending on what you were interested in. I chose the middle-grade section. I had trouble deciding between that and the young adult section. Figured I would try that one this time and the young adult one next time. The two women who spoke in our section were editors in a publishing company. I also thought I had an in when they mentioned that they were from Brooklyn, same place as me. I made sure to mention it during introductions. This way, if I ever submit anything to them, I will reference it during my letter. So , there I am thinking that everything is perfect and they will read the first page and offer me a contract right away. Instead, they made suggestions to critique the first page. That's all you submitted, was the first page. They definitely gave good suggestions to enhance appeal to an editor. When i got home, I immediately went to work on it, following their advice. Again, keeping my finger's crossed that this thing pays off. It is a dream of mine. Let's hope.
